2.3 Additional safety instructions for instruments with ATEX approval
(TR30-P, TR30-W)
WARNING!
■
Follow the requirements of the 94/9/EC (ATEX) directive.
■
Additionally the specifications of the respective national regulations
concerning Ex-usage (e.g. EN 60079-10 and EN 60079-14) apply.
■
Non-observance of these instructions and their contents may result in the
loss of explosion protection.
■
The responsibility for classification of zones lies with the plant operator and not the
manufacturer/supplier of the equipment.
■
The plant operator guarantees, and is solely responsible, that all thermometers
in use are identifiable with respect to all safety-relevant characteristics. Damaged
thermometers may not be used.
■
Electrical screening may only be grounded at one end, and outside of the Ex area.
Special cases are described in DIN EN 60079-14:2003.
■
There must be a galvanic separation between the intrinsically safe and the
non-intrinsically safe electrical circuits.
2.4 Special hazards
WARNING!
Observe the information given in the applicable type examination certificate
and the relevant country-specific regulations for installation and use
in potentially explosive atmospheres (e.g. IEC 60079-14, NEC, CEC).
Non-observance can result in serious injury and/or damage to the equipment.

WARNING!
For hazardous media such as oxygen, acetylene, flammable or toxic gases or
liquids, and refrigeration plants, compressors, etc., in addition to all standard
regulations, the appropriate existing codes or regulations must also be
followed.
WARNING!
Protection from electrostatic discharge (ESD) required.
The proper use of grounded work surfaces and personal wrist straps is required
when working with exposed circuitry (printed circuit boards), in order to prevent
static discharge from damaging sensitive electronic components.
